What the Data Says About Alliya

The Social Security Administration has registered 224 babies named Alliya between 1995 and 2017, spanning 23 consecutive years of U.S. birth records. As a girl's name, Alliya currently falls outside the top 1,000 girls' names for 2017. The name reached its historical peak in 2002, when 18 babies received it in a single year.

Decade-level aggregation shows that Alliya performed strongest in the 2000s, accumulating 137 births during that ten-year window. Across the 3 decades of recorded activity, Alliya shows a clear decline from its mid-century high.

These figures derive from SSA's annual national and state-level name files, which include any name appearing at least five times in a given year or state-year; names below that threshold are suppressed for privacy and therefore excluded from the totals shown here. The 224 total represents a lower bound — actual usage may be higher in years or states where the count fell below the disclosure floor.
